The National Candidacy Commission will conclude this Friday the process of interviews and consultations with the deputies to the National Assembly of People's Power, who made their proposals for the new leadership of Parliament and members of the State Council. 

Alfredo Machado López, deputy-chairman of the Nominations Committee, informed the press that it was a very important step in which the 605 parliamentarians, elected on March 11, proposed selected candidates from within that quarry to assume the positions of President, Vice President and Secretary of the National Assembly.

At the moment, the candidacy projects are being prepared, which will be presented on April 19, when the new head of the highest legislative body and the President, First Vice President, Vice Presidents and other members of the State Council will be elected.

These consultations are part of the process of general elections in Cuba convened since June 2017, in which, in a first stage, the municipal delegates of the Popular Power were elected, and then the provincial representatives and deputies were voted.
